Left for 6 days for a fun trip to the Georgia Aquarium then spending 3 day lounging on the beaches of Daytona. Did a water change in my 75g. Checked to make sure all numbers were spot on, had the lighting timer set for 11 hours of daylight, all good, been up and running for 2 and a half years. Well, we arrived back home today to find my tank lights off, powerheads shut down and the tank was foul! :eek3: Apparently we must have had a power surge from a storm because 3 switches were tripped in our breaker box. Unfortunately one breaker controlled my aquarium and other was the deep freeze. You can only imagine how bad that was.
My wife turned on the fax machine and sure enough, according to the fax machine the power went off the night we left so my fish were sitting in still water with no lighting and no water movement for 6 days. Most of my corals died. The only survivors were about half of the mushroom corals. My yellow tang died. I had 5 blue/green chromis'.
Only two survived.
I've had a stubborn yellow tail damsel in their this whole time. He lived. So now my only survivors are the damsel, two blue/greens, some nassarius snails and mushroom corals. I instantly changed up 10 gallons as an emergency to remove some of the stench and other toxic buildup. Later in the day after a few hours of lighting and power heads running the damsel and chromises starting coming out of hiding. THis upsets me. when I first got my mushrooms they started as ten attached to a rock. Over the last few years they balooned to over sixty of them.
So now what? After removing dead items and the water change the stench from the water was gone. Should I do another water change tomorrow? Watch all my numbers? Thanks
